public UI_ThemNhanVien(Grid gridMain, DTO_NhanVien obj)
        {
            InitializeComponent();
            DataContext                     = new TextFieldsViewModel();
            this.gridMain                   = gridMain;
            isChangingVisible               = false;
            cbbPermissionName.ItemsSource   = BUS_PhanQuyen.showData();
            cbbPermissionName.SelectedIndex = 0;
            if (obj == null)
            {
                AutoGenerateID();
                btnVisible.IsChecked = true;
                isNew = true;
            }
            else
            {
                txtEmployeesID.Text       = obj.MaNhanVien;
                txtEmployeesName.Text     = obj.TenNhanVien;
                txtEmployeesUserName.Text = obj.UserName;
                txtEmployeesPass.Password = obj.Password;
                cbbPermissionName.Text    = obj.TenPhanQuyen;

                if (obj.TrangThai == false)
                {
                    btnVisible.IsChecked           = false;
                    txtEmployeesID.FontStyle       = FontStyles.Oblique;
                    txtEmployeesName.FontStyle     = FontStyles.Oblique;
                    txtEmployeesUserName.FontStyle = FontStyles.Oblique;
                    txtEmployeesPass.FontStyle     = FontStyles.Oblique;
                    cbbPermissionName.FontStyle    = FontStyles.Oblique;
                }
                isNew = false;
            }
        }
Beispiel #2
0
        public CashOut()
        {
            InitializeComponent();
            DataContext = new TextFieldsViewModel();

            setInitialValues();
        }
 public UI_ThemHangHoa()
 {
     InitializeComponent();
     DataContext = new TextFieldsViewModel();
     generateHangHoaID();
     isNew = true;
     loadCombobox();
 }
Beispiel #4
0
 public UI_ThemPhieuNhap(Grid gridMain, DTO_PhieuNhap obj)
 {
     InitializeComponent();
     DataContext   = new TextFieldsViewModel();
     this.gridMain = gridMain;
     if (obj == null)
     {
         generatePhieuNhapID();
         checkGroupCTPN(isNew = true, item);
     }
     else
     {
         getDataFromEditUI(obj);
         checkGroupCTPN(isNew = false, obj);
     }
 }
 public UI_ThemNhaCungCap(Grid gridMain, DTO_NhaCungCap obj)
 {
     InitializeComponent();
     DataContext   = new TextFieldsViewModel();
     this.gridMain = gridMain;
     if (obj == null)
     {
         AutoGenerateID();
         isNew = true;
     }
     else
     {
         txtSupplierID.Text      = obj.MaNhaCungCap;
         txtSupplierName.Text    = obj.TenNhaCungCap;
         txtSupplierAddress.Text = obj.DiaChi;
         txtSupplierPhone.Text   = obj.SoDienThoai;
         txtSupplierEmail.Text   = obj.Email;
         isNew = false;
     }
 }
Beispiel #6
0
 public TextFields()
 {
     InitializeComponent();
     DataContext = new TextFieldsViewModel();
 }
        public TextFields()
        {
            InitializeComponent();	        
			DataContext = new TextFieldsViewModel();			
		}
        public FieldsDemo()
        {
            this.InitializeComponent();

            DataContext = new TextFieldsViewModel();
        }
Beispiel #9
0
 private void Window_Loaded(object sender, RoutedEventArgs e)
 {
     cbbTenHangHoa.ItemsSource = BUS_HangHoa.showData();
     DataContext = new TextFieldsViewModel();
 }
Beispiel #10
0
 public ucSystemSettings()
 {
     InitializeComponent();
     DataContext = new TextFieldsViewModel();
 }
 public UI_ThayDoiMatKhau()
 {
     InitializeComponent();
     DataContext = new TextFieldsViewModel();
 }